What Payment Methods Can I Use?

Most online casinos offer various payment options for deposits and withdrawals. Common methods include:

  • Credit/Debit Cards: Visa, MasterCard, and sometimes others.
  • E-Wallets: P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ller are popular choices.
  • Bank Transfers: Direct bank transfer options may be available.
  • Cryptocurrency: Some casinos accept Bitcoin and other digital currencies.

Always check for any fees or processing times associated with each method.

Common Myths about Playing Poker Online

Let’s clear up some common misconceptions:

  • Myth 1: Online poker is rigged.
    Fact: Reputable casinos use Random Number Generators (RNG) to ensure fair play.
  • Myth 2: You need to be a professional to win.
    Fact: Many beginners win with basic strategies and practice.
  • Myth 3: All poker games are the same.
    Fact: Different variants like Texas Hold’em and Omaha have unique rules and strategies.
